Technological Innovations Reshaping the Industry
Over the past decade, advancements such as live dealer platforms, immersive virtual and augmented reality experiences, and AI-driven personalised offers have significantly transformed online gambling. These innovations aim to enhance user engagement while maintaining transparency and fairness.
For instance, live dealer games replicate the casino atmosphere, attracting players seeking social interaction, a trend evidenced by industry data indicating a 45% increase in live dealer participation globally between 2018 and 2022 (Source: Gambling Industry Report 2023). Meanwhile, virtual reality experiences are still emerging but promise to take immersion further, especially appealing to younger demographics.

The Critical Role of Responsible Gambling
Amidst these innovations, the industry faces the crucial challenge of ensuring players gamble responsibly. The proliferation of easy-to-access betting platforms, coupled with real-time notifications and personalised marketing, can inadvertently lead to problematic behaviours if not carefully managed.
“Responsible gambling isn’t merely a regulatory requirement but a core ethical imperative for industry sustainability,” states Dr. Emily Carter, chair of the UK Responsible Gambling Trust.
Initiatives like self-exclusion programmes, real-time risk assessments, and clear, accessible information about odds and risks are now standard. The importance of these measures cannot be overstated; they serve both as preventative tools and as markers of an industry’s commitment to player welfare.
Regulatory Frameworks and Industry Standards
The UK’s Gambling Commission has set a high bar for regulatory standards, mandating rigorous age verification, secure payment systems, and responsible gambling tools. Operators are increasingly adopting advanced analytics to detect signs of problem gambling early and intervene proactively.
Such compliance isn’t only legal compliance but also an ethical branding strategy—building trust with discerning consumers increasingly aware of gambling risks.
